Output 249cae7463ad1efcbd7d4a6c174920d6a732f7a9008ca3c8e63cdc33c1d15f84:10

value
3091408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eff59777d0998a404f8db781d422203710b01fc OP_EQUAL
address
334KHDquwVHsHVUW43AUFSdFkJNutLrSjy
transaction
249cae7463ad1efcbd7d4a6c174920d6a732f7a9008ca3c8e63cdc33c1d15f84
spent
true